Historical Context:
Henry Wadsworth Longfellow (1807–1882) was one of the most celebrated American poets of the 19th century. A central figure of the Fireside Poets, Longfellow achieved national and international acclaim for works such as Paul Revere’s Ride, The Song of Hiawatha, and Evangeline. His poetry, known for its lyrical style and accessible themes, played a significant role in shaping American literary identity during the mid-1800s.
Longfellow was the first American to be honored with a memorial bust in Westminster Abbey’s Poets’ Corner, reflecting his global literary stature.
